How To Change the Default Search Engine in Windows 8′s Internet Explorer 10
Oct 31st 2012, 10:00

image

You can change the default search provider in the Modern version of Internet Explorer 10, but Microsoft hides this option well. You won't find it in IE's Settings charm – you'll have to change this setting from the desktop.

After you change this setting on the desktop, both versions of Internet Explorer will use your preferred search engine. You'll have to use the desktop to change certain settings on Windows tablets — even Windows RT includes a limited desktop.
